Hi there - New to Perth
G'day guys,
Doug said I should drop by and say hi. New to Perth from Brisbane, work brought me over. Hoping to get into seeing some of the car scene here as life is quite boring without something to tinker on, and somewhere/thing to drive. Was looking for last few weeks for a tidy gen 4 gt or GDx wrx. Didnt have much luck with finding the right car so picked up a 1JZ soarer. $3k rego'd and in decent condition, engine pulls strong and behaves itself nicely, drivetrain is stock and unmolested. Kid put a set of terrible backward cap wheels on but aside from that it's a mint commuter for the 70k drive up the tonkin to work. Just spent the weekend inspecting it. Has 4 different shocks, dodgy heater DIY going on, open diff and needs a few interior bits and pieces to be replaced. No plans for it aside from some 17's, bilsteins and maybe an LSD. Definitely dont want to start throwing money at it unless some serious bargains pop up on gumtree/antilag. Previous cars were a fairly spastic 3.0RB with ohlins, lots of messing about with fabricated suspension components, 100mm wider track, big rubber and big brakes etc. Hills car. First BRZ in the country. Owned for 3 weeks and sold because I wasnt impressed at all. Did nothing as a car I couldnt get from a dunger old liberty. Gen 3 with various sages of tinkering culminating with a 1GZ-FE tojo V12 and a couple of TD06 20g's with an R230 and TH400. Skid car. Ran well but when it munched then TH400 I cracked the shits, a little scared of it developing an electrical failure from a conrod hitting a battery, and parted it out. Currently a HQ styleside ute with a 1000hp 1UZ long block sitting in the tray, awaiting a GT40 or 42 slapped on. Shortened 9". 1350 spicers. PS2000, speedhut dash and bumper to bumper bare bones loom done. Totally rust free, straight and in great condition which is rare for a HQ; Interior is new, paint is fresh etc. Currently has a W55 in it but it wont be on the road until its finished. Sadly because it's in Brissy still it's a complete chequebook racer car having Al at AM auto tinker as required. Plans are to throw the big engine in, flex fuel, TH400, 94mm turbo, and bring it over to the west. Look forward to maybe seeing some of you out on a cruise or something. Seems to be a bit underground when it comes to car scene over here, for whatever reason. Big shout out to Doug at Stechnic already for though for gracious use of his time and workshop to inspect my new shitbox. Absolutely top bloke as I'm sure is already known by you all. Will upload some pics of the ute and soarer as I make progress. Welcome to the zoo.
Car scene in Perth is not so much underground, more mildly concealed. A response to the style of policing over here I would suspect. Antilag is probably the biggest in the state, and organises some pretty awesome events (i.e Racewars), PWRX seems to have faded a bit from the 'scene' in the last 18months or so, but we do still hold different events every few weeks. Lot's of people here selling their WRX's too so it shouldn't be hard to find something you like.

Way down here in Collie there are a few events that maybe up your alley.
Collie Motorsports Group hold a chrome bumper day, and a Fathers Day, both are for power skids, burn outs, show and shine etc. Theres also the Gazza Nats which is more of the same. Your ute would fit in well. And welcome.
